About Sharon McNeil
Her counseling style is warm, positive, and interactive, with an emphasis on respect, sensitivity, and compassion. Sharon believes that maintaining a hopeful, strengths-based perspective can be an important part of creating change, especially during stressful or uncertain seasons of life.
Sharon integrates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), client-centered therapy, and solution-focused therapy. She tailors each session and the overall treatment plan to the individual, adjusting the approach to fit a client’s needs, goals, and situation. Practical Therapy Approaches, Accessible Online
Sharon McNeil draws from Client-Centered Therapy,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), and Solution-Focused Therapy to support clients facing concerns like anxiety, depression, stress, relationship challenges, parenting pressures, career concerns, and ADHD.Client-Centered Therapy focuses on creating a supportive space where clients feel respected and understood, helping them clarify what matters most and build self-trust as they move through change. CBT is a structured, skills-based approach that looks at how thoughts, emotions, and behaviors interact, often helping people develop practical strategies for anxiety, low mood, and unhelpful patterns. Solution-Focused Therapy emphasizes strengths and small, achievable steps, which can be especially useful when clients want to define goals and make progress without getting stuck in overwhelm.
Finding the right approach is part of the process. Sharon collaborates with clients to shape sessions around their needs, goals, and preferences, adjusting the pace and focus as therapy unfolds.
